Deep-link routing on Wayfern mobile: every marketing link resolves through the Linkloom router before the app opens a screen, so a bad route map means users land on a blank view. As release manager, you own the route-map promotion step — run linkloom promote after QA signs off. The promoter validates each route against the registry database, and it connects using the string right below.

replica DSN, tawef-hahap: mysql://eliix_svc:FiIC0jz@db-394a.lumiclabs.internal:5432/holius

## Service Accounts: Burrowlight Cache Tier

Heads up, support folks — after the stale-cache mess in March (stale prices served for four hours, you all remember the ticket flood), we split the cache service account from the main app account. The postmortem found one shared credential meant we couldn't revoke cache access without taking down checkout. Now the cache invalidator runs under its own account with a scoped key. When reproducing customer-reported staleness, use that account. Its key is the one listed below.

service key, kageg-bafog: zpat15_h7D54RaqPe9BMFd

## Authentication

The Cartwheel load-test harness hits the Tillford checkout flow through the internal gateway, never production payment rails. All synthetic orders are tagged and purged nightly. Maintainers should rotate the harness credential whenever the gateway version bumps, since scopes occasionally change. The harness authenticates to the gateway using the key below.

service key, fawip-bajef: kto11_Qt5wZK9vdNC

Handover: Skylark search relevance tuning notes now live in the Brightquay runbook, sections 3–5. Synonym weights are frozen for this release; the BM25 override stays experimental and must not ship. Regression queries run nightly; check the drift dashboard before cutting the build. Any relevance questions should be directed to the owner named below.

signatory, kagag-haweg: Caswyn Kasion

TICKET #—Shuttle-bus gate, Dockside entrance

Gate motor at the Harrowmere shuttle stop is sticking again. Contractor due tomorrow morning. Until then, night shift must open it manually for the 22:40 and 02:10 shuttles. Do not leave it propped. If the keypad times out, reset it from the panel inside the guard hut. The override pass code for the panel is below.

door code, fawip-yagef: bdg-NPIWQ-43434